What currency is used in San Miguel de Allende?
In San Miguel de Allende, the currency utilized is the Mexican peso, consistent with the entire nation. This is the currency you will commonly use for meals, transportation, shopping, entry fees, tips, and everyday purchases.
While this may seem straightforward, it is crucial because many travelers mistakenly believe that a popular tourist destination will widely accept US dollars. This assumption can complicate daily spending and lead to unexpected challenges.
The simple yet effective guideline is to think in pesos, budget using pesos, and pay in pesos whenever feasible.
Should you use pesos or US dollars in San Miguel de Allende?
The recommendation is clear: pesos are the better choice for everyday transactions. Although some tourist-centric establishments might accept US dollars, relying on dollars is not the most advantageous approach.
The primary concern with using dollars isn't about their acceptance; it's that the conversion rate applied at the moment may be less favorable than simply using pesos. This can ultimately cost you more.

Should you rely on cards or carry cash for your expenses?
The most effective strategy is to utilize both cash and cards, but avoid depending solely on one or the other.
Credit and debit cards are beneficial at many hotels, upscale restaurants, and larger retail establishments. However, cash remains crucial for smaller transactions, local markets, tipping, quick purchases, and scenarios where card payments could introduce unnecessary complications.
| Payment Method | Best For | Considerations |
|---|---|---|
| Cash in Pesos | Tipping, markets, small vendors, flexible daily purchases | Limit cash to what you need for the day |
| Credit or Debit Card | Hotels, higher-end restaurants, substantial purchases | Always have a backup payment method ready in case of card machine issues |
| US Dollars | Backup only | Not practical for daily transactions and often comes with a poorer exchange rate |

How should you use ATMs safely and effectively in San Miguel de Allende?
For numerous travelers, ATMs offer the simplest way to obtain pesos upon arrival. The objective is not to avoid ATMs but rather to use them wisely.
An effective ATM usage strategy involves withdrawing cash during daylight hours, choosing ATMs located in busy and secure areas, keeping an alternative card handy if possible, and ensuring you do not find yourself in a situation where a failed transaction disrupts your day.
Smart Habits for ATM Usage
- Withdraw cash during the day, rather than late at night.
- Avoid waiting until you are completely out of cash.
- Carry more than one payment option for flexibility.
- Carefully review fees and prompts on the screen before confirming any transaction.
- Maintain a reasonable cash limit for daily expenses.
What essential tips should you know about tipping in San Miguel de Allende?
Tipping remains a significant reason why cash is still relevant, even when cards are accepted. Relying solely on card payments can lead to uncomfortable situations during small transactions.
The amount you tip can differ based on the circumstance, but the key takeaway is to keep small bills or change available to tip effortlessly and without complicating straightforward interactions.
